Let’s start from the very beginning. The raw materials are the first thing we need to talk about. Usually, we use different types of fibers, like cotton, polyester, acrylic, or a blend of them. These fibers come in the form of spools of yarn. The quality of the raw materials really matters because it directly affects the quality of the final chenille yarn.
Now, onto the actual machine. The basic components of a Chenille Yarn Machine include a drafting system, a cutting mechanism, a core yarn feeder, and a twisting unit. Each part has its own job to do, and they all work together to create that beautiful chenille yarn.
The drafting system is where it all starts. This part is responsible for pulling the fibers from the spools and straightening them out. It uses a series of rollers that rotate at different speeds to stretch and align the fibers. This step is super important because it ensures that the fibers are evenly distributed and strong enough to be processed further. You can think of it like combing your hair to get rid of all the tangles and make it smooth.
Once the fibers are drafted, they move on to the cutting mechanism. This is where the magic really happens. The cutting mechanism cuts the drafted fibers into short lengths, called "piles." These piles are what give chenille yarn its characteristic fuzzy appearance. The length of the piles can be adjusted depending on the desired look and feel of the final yarn. Some people like a shorter, more compact pile for a smoother finish, while others prefer a longer, more luxurious pile.
While the piles are being cut, the core yarn feeder is working in parallel. The core yarn is the strong, central thread that holds all the piles together. It’s usually made from a more durable fiber, like polyester or nylon. The core yarn feeder carefully feeds the core yarn into the machine at the right time and speed. It’s a bit like a conductor leading an orchestra, making sure everything is in sync.
Now, the next crucial step is the twisting unit. The piles and the core yarn meet at the twisting unit, where they are twisted together. This twisting action binds the piles to the core yarn, creating a cohesive chenille yarn. The amount of twist can also be adjusted to change the appearance and texture of the yarn. A higher twist will make the yarn more compact and less fluffy, while a lower twist will result in a softer, more billowy yarn.
Throughout the process, there are also some control systems in place. These systems monitor things like the speed of the rollers, the length of the piles, and the amount of twist. They make sure that everything is running smoothly and that the quality of the yarn is consistent. If there’s any problem, like a jam or a break in the yarn, the control systems can detect it and stop the machine automatically. This helps to prevent any damage to the machine and ensures that we can quickly fix the issue.
